All Wales Direct Production Timber Harvesting Services Dynamic Market (updated)

Description
PLEASE NOTE: this is an updated UK2 Notice. The updated notice includes the link to "Register to Attend" the Briefing Session on 16 September 2025 and the "Supplier Questionnaire". Natural Resources Wales intends to set up a Dynamic Market (OM) to secure Direct Production timber harvesting operations via thinning and clear felling. NRW require direct labour services to provide expert felling, processing and extraction of timber to roadside to support current and future Timber Sales and Marketing Plans across the Welsh Government Woodland Estate. Key harvesting services sought include both mechanised and motor manual felling as well as the deployment of winch machinery to deliver steep-ground working without viable mechanised felling access. Other services required include alternative harvesting machinery such as shears and the delivery of mechanised vegetation clearance, to respond to Statutory Plant Health Notices on unmerchantable stands. As part of early market engagement, Natural Resources Wales (NRW) is inviting potential contractors to participate in our pre-market engagement (PME) activities. We are particularly interested in hearing from Small and Medium Enterprises (SMEs) with the expertise to meet our requirements. The purpose of the engagement is to gather market insight, help shape NRW's approach to developing a dynamic market for the supply of direct production harvesting services and ensure suppliers are aware of the upcoming opportunity as early as possible. This is not a call for competition and participation is voluntary.
